About Optical Networks’s Workforce
Optical Networks SAC is a Telecommunications Services company that employs 389 people worldwide as of March 2026. It is the 11th-largest by headcount among its peers. Founded in 2003, the company is headquartered in San Isidro, Peru.
Optical Networks's workforce has declined 21.4% from 2023 to 2026, though it is up 0.3% year over year in 2026. It fell to a low of 389 in 2026 Q1 before recovering. Its workforce is concentrated most in South America (75.8%), followed by South Asia (16.3%) and Southeast Asia (1.5%).
Optical Networks's functional groups are Finance and Operations (47.9%), Engineering (36.8%), and Sales and Marketing (15.3%). The average salary is $16,635, ranging from a median of $47,000 in North America to $4,000 in South Asia, down 1.7% year over year in 2026.
Optical Networks's active job postings fell 11.1% in 2026 to 17, with new postings per month climbing from 0 in 2023 to 8 in 2026. Overall employee sentiment is negative and broadly stable.
Sourced from Revelio Labs workforce data.
